Lanway unveils comms business
New business unit to bolster Lanway’s comms offering
VAR Lanway has named Marc Monaghan as business manager for its new communications unit.
Monaghan (pictured) has worked for the Burnley-based company for eight years, having previously been a telecoms engineer. He will be tasked with driving Lanway’s sales and service development in the voice and data arena, “creating bespoke, unified solutions for clients,” according to the firm.
The communications unit includes partnerships with vendors such as Avaya, Polycom and Microsoft.
Commenting on his appointment, Marc says: “Lanway is a rapidly growing business and I’m relishing the opportunity to drive the communications unit forward.”
Adds Andrew Henderson, chief executive of Lanway: “Marc’s achieved a lot for the company over the last eight years, and I know he’s got the drive and creativity to make our new unit a success.”
